Which sentence best describes the thematic characteristics of Renaissance
stiv31 [10]

Answer:

Renaissance art had both religious and secular themes.

Explanation: Renaissance art is the art that emerged in Europe during the 15th century as paintings, sculptures and others, by the time there had been important developments in different areas such as science, philosophy, and literature. This type of art mixed the art of the Classical antiquity, that refers to the historical period of Ancient Greece and Ancient Rome, and the new developments guided by science, as well as new artistic techniques. Because of this, Renaissance art themes included myths and biblical scenes (Religious themes) but also, humanistic and Renaissance themes and techniques guided by the new discoveries and developments (Secular themes).
